Removing and Returning an Authorization Code
Purpose
Returns an authorization code back to the
license pool in CSSM. A return code is
displayed after you enter this command.
Specify the product instance:
• all: Performs the action for all connected
product instances in a High Availability
set-up.
• local: Performs the action for the active
product instance. This is the default option.
Specify if you are connected to CSSM or not:
• If connected to CSSM, enter online. The
code is automatically returned to CSSM
and a confirmation is returned and installed
on the product instance. If you choose this
option, the return code is automatically
submitted to CSSM.
• If not connected to CSSM, enter offline
[filepath_filename].
If you do not specify a filename and path,
the return code is displayed on the CLI. If
you specify a file name and path, the return
code is saved in the specified location. The
file format can be any readable format. For
example:
Device# license smart
authorization return local offline
bootflash:return-code.txt
If you choose the offline option, you must
complete the additional step of copying
the return code from the CLI or the saved
file and entering it in CSSM. See:
Removing the Product Instance from
CSSM, on page
156. Proceed with the next
step only after you complete this step.
Enters the global configuration mode.
Disables SLR configuration on the product
instance.
